Bullet Proof Adjustable 2 Ball Mount Durability Compared to Similar Options  

Question:

This looks, and specs out, to be a very heavy duty hitch. My question to Etrailer is having the experience to compare against many other manufacturers and knowing reviews from customer testing, is the hitch durable and able to withstand heavy use? I would mainly be using the 2 5/16 ball in a rise/drop position. I have several trucks that it would used with so the ease of adjustability would be very handy. I know the hitch is not the prettiest or shiniest but those things dont matter when hauling a load. I want it to be worth the price, easy to swap between trucks, durable, and most of all safe! Thanks

0

Expert Reply:

The BulletProof Hitches Adjustable 2-Ball Mount for 2" Hitch - 10" Drop/Rise - 22,000 lbs # HD2010 is a very strong and durable hitch whether used in the rise or drop position. The unit is rated to pull that 22K with the 2-5/16 inch ball you referenced and that doesn't change whether used in the highest rise or the lowest drop position which those extremes would have the most torque on the unit itself. The tongue weight for this ball mount is rated for a maximum of 3,000 lbs. As you stated this specs out to be very heavy duty and customers have been pleased with it compared to the other options linked.

In many cases this ball mount will be rated stronger than the trailer hitch receiver on your truck and able to tow more than many trucks are rated for towing. It is a great product that will serve you well.
